PEOPLE v. CAMPISI


213 A.D.2d 186 (1995)

623 N.Y.S.2d 232

The People of the State of New York, Respondent, v. Anthony Campisi, Also Known Angel Carzoglio,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, First Department.

March 7, 1995


Defendant has failed to preserve two of his claims regarding the admission of evidence of uncharged crimes (People v Guerrero, 191 A.D.2d 251, lv denied 81 N.Y.2d 1014), and we decline to review them in the interest of justice.
